The Note That Changed Everything: A Schoolyard Tale of Love and Jealousy

Oliver was rummaging through his backpack when he spotted a folded piece of paper tucked between his notebooks. He unfolded it carefully, and his heart gave a little leap:
“Hey! I really like you. If you want to meet, I’ll be waiting behind the school at four today.”

He blinked in surprise, even a bit flustered. Who on earth could’ve left this? Curiosity got the better of him. At exactly four, he was there—and suddenly, he saw Emily. The quiet, shy new girl.

“Was this from you?” he asked cautiously.
“What?” Emily looked baffled, as if he’d spoken in riddles. “Me? No!”

“Then why are you here? Are you… waiting for me?”
“Well… Charlotte told me you liked me,” she mumbled, turning scarlet.

Oliver frowned. Things were getting weirder by the second.

**The Move That Turned Everything Upside Down**
Emily’s parents had bought a bigger house in a nicer neighbourhood, which meant switching schools. Sure, the new place was lovely, but her old friends were miles away. Her parents insisted: “There’s a school right here! You’ll settle in.”

Emily protested—loudly. Starting fresh in Year 10, when cliques had long since formed, was terrifying. But no one listened.

“You’ll make friends!” her mum chirped. “You’re such a sociable girl!”

Except she wasn’t. Emily had always struggled with people. At her new school, she hovered on the edges, answering questions in monosyllables, avoiding eye contact. Soon, everyone stopped trying.

She didn’t mind—she was just different. Quiet, watchful. And secretly, she admired Oliver—the class charmer, quick with a joke, everyone’s favourite.

She fancied him. Badly. But the idea of actually speaking to him? Impossible.

**Green-Eyed Monsters in the Classroom**
Charlotte noticed. Confident, sharp-tongued Charlotte, who’d fancied Oliver forever but was firmly stuck in the “just mates” zone.

Seeing Emily’s shy glances at Oliver boiled her blood. Time to put the new girl in her place.

“Let’s prank her,” she told her mates. “We’ll slip Oliver a note from a ‘secret admirer,’ then tell Emily he fancies her. Watch her embarrass herself!”

After some hesitation, they agreed. Charlotte sidled up to Emily with saccharine sweetness.

“Oliver likes you. Want me to check if it’s true?”

Emily’s eyes lit up—which only made Charlotte angrier.

“He’ll ask to meet you,” she said. “Behind school, at four. Keep it quiet, okay?”

“Okay,” Emily whispered, equal parts thrilled and terrified.

**The Ending No One Saw Coming**
The next day, Charlotte slipped the note into Oliver’s bag. He read it—puzzled, intrigued.

He showed up. And there was Emily. Emily, who looked just as shocked to see him.

“Did you write this?”
“No… I was told you…”

Oliver pieced it together. He sighed. He knew Charlotte’s games too well.

But Emily had come. Did that mean…?

“If you’re here, does that mean you *do* like me?” He grinned.

Emily turned crimson. She wanted to bolt. But Oliver stopped her.

“Since we’re both here… Fancy a walk?”

Charlotte, hiding around the corner with her phone recording, gaped. This wasn’t the plan. None of this was supposed to happen.

Worse? The next day, Oliver and Emily walked into class together. Laughing. Smiling.

**Aftermath**
“Was this payback?” Charlotte hissed at Oliver at break.

“Nope. You introduced us. Cheers for that, honestly. We get on brilliantly.”

Charlotte refused to believe it. She waited for the fallout, for it all to collapse.

Months passed. They stayed together. School ended. They moved in. Eventually, a wedding.

And only then did Charlotte finally accept it: her prank had backfired spectacularly.

**The Moral?**
Before you scheme or sneer—think twice. Sometimes fate has a funny way of fixing things itself.
